NAMEPaws::KinesisAnalytics::D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figuration - Arguments for method D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figuration on Paws::KinesisAnalytics DESCRIPTIONThis class represents the parameters used for calling the method D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figuration on the Amazon Kinesis Analytics service. Use the attributes of this class as arguments to method D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figuration. You shouldn't make instances of this class. Each attribute should be used as a named argument in the call to D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figuration. SYNOPSISmy $kinesisanalytics = Paws->service('KinesisAnalytics'); my $D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figurationResponse = $kinesisanalytics->D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figuration( ApplicationName => 'MyApplicationName', CurrentApplicationVersionId => 1, InputId => 'MyId', ); Values for attributes that are native types (Int, String, Float, etc) can passed as-is (scalar values). Values for complex Types (objects) can be passed as a HashRef. The keys and values of the hashref will be used to instance the underlying object. For the AWS API documentation, see <https://docs.aws.amazon.com/goto/WebAPI/kinesisanalytics/DeleteApplicationInputProcessingConfiguration> ATTRIBUTESREQUIRED ApplicationName => StrThe Kinesis Analytics application name. REQUIRED CurrentApplicationVersionId => IntThe version ID of the Kinesis Analytics application. REQUIRED InputId => StrThe ID of the input configuration from which to delete the input processing configuration. You can get a list of the input IDs for an application by using the DescribeApplication (https://docs.aws.amazon.com/kinesisanalytics/latest/dev/API_DescribeApplication.html) operation.
